Hbox Digital
AI Engineer

Discover new opportunities

AI Engineer

Job Description

  • We are looking for a skilled AI Engineer to join our technology team and help build intelligent digital products that solve real business problems.
  • The ideal candidate should have a strong understanding of machine learning, natural language processing, AI automation, data processing, and model integration within modern web and mobile applications.
  • This role is focused on designing, developing, and deploying AI driven features that improve user experience, automate business workflows, and support smarter decision making.
  • The right candidate should be comfortable working with AI models, APIs, data pipelines, prompt engineering, model testing, and performance optimization.

Responsibilities

  • Design and develop AI based features for mobile apps, web platforms, SaaS products, and internal business tools.
  • Work with machine learning models, large language models, automation workflows, and AI APIs.
  • Build AI solutions for chatbots, recommendation systems, content generation, smart search, image analysis, predictive analytics, and workflow automation.
  • Integrate third party AI services such as OpenAI, Google AI, AWS AI services, Azure AI, and other model providers when required.
  • Prepare, clean, structure, and analyze data for AI model development and testing.
  • Create prompts, workflows, and logic flows that improve AI output quality and business usefulness.
  • Collaborate with developers to connect AI features with backend systems, databases, and user facing applications.
  • Test AI outputs for accuracy, reliability, bias, usability, and business relevance.
  • Optimize AI features for speed, cost efficiency, scalability, and security.
  • Document AI workflows, technical logic, model behavior, limitations, and integration requirements.
  • Stay updated with modern AI tools, frameworks, and practical use cases that can improve company products and client projects.

Preferred Qualifications

  • 2 to 4 years of experience in AI engineering, machine learning, data science, or software development with AI integration.
  • Strong knowledge of Python and common AI or data libraries.
  • Experience working with large language models, AI APIs, prompt engineering, and automation tools.
  • Understanding of machine learning concepts such as classification, prediction, clustering, embeddings, model training, and evaluation.
  • Experience with NLP, computer vision, recommendation engines, or generative AI is a strong plus.
  • Familiarity with backend development, REST APIs, databases, and cloud platforms.
  • Ability to convert business requirements into practical AI based solutions.
  • Strong problem solving skills and ability to test AI systems with a skeptical, quality focused mindset.
  • Good communication skills and ability to explain technical AI concepts in simple business language.
  • Bachelor’s degree in Computer Science, Artificial Intelligence, Data Science, Software Engineering, or a related field is preferred.